gfLABS Research & Development Intern, Neural Processing Unit and Hardware Accelerator Architectures (Summer 2026)
GlobalFoundries is a leading full-service semiconductor foundry that provides design, development, and fabrication services. They are seeking a Research & Development Intern to engage in advanced system-level analysis of Neural Processing Unit architectures, focusing on hardware accelerator architectures and digital design principles.
ElectronicsManufacturingSemiconductor
Responsibilities
Conduct in-depth architectural analysis of NPUs, emphasizing dataflow optimization and memory hierarchy
Investigate the performance and efficiency of systolic array configurations and their integration with buffer memory systems
Perform RTL synthesis and Place-and-Route (PnR) using industry-standard EDA tools
Analyze Power, Performance, and Area (PPA) metrics to guide design decisions and architectural trade-offs
